Abstract
This paper presents the knowledge representation schemes adopted in MI CKEY, a knowledge based system for designing microprocessor based syst ems, MICKEY is essentially a hybrid expert system, using rules and pro cedures for achieving the different design tasks. We briefly describe the hierarchy of tasks in this problem domain, and emphasize on the re finement paradigm, constraint propagation, conflict resolution and tas k management strategies adopted in MICKEY. Next, we dwell upon the dif ferent knowledge sources and their functions, with respect to the part icular design domain, Finally, we present an industrial design, achiev ed by MICKEY, to demonstrate its applicability.
